Assess Your Fleet’s Unique Profile

Before you can compare different types of equipment, you must first develop a clear picture of your fleet’s characteristics and washing needs. A thorough assessment is the foundation for making a smart investment.

Fleet Size and Wash Volume

The number of vehicles you operate is the most significant factor in determining the right type of wash system.

  • Small Fleets (1-15 trucks): A small fleet with infrequent washing needs might manage with a high-quality manual pressure washing setup. However, as labor costs rise, even small operations can benefit from a compact, automated gantry system to improve consistency and save time.
  • Medium Fleets (15-50 trucks): At this size, manual washing becomes a serious operational bottleneck. The time and labor costs quickly add up, making an automated system a much more viable option. A rollover/gantry system or a basic drive-through system can provide significant efficiency gains.
  • Large Fleets (50+ trucks): For large-scale operations, a high-throughput, automated drive-through system is almost always the most effective choice. The ability to wash a truck in minutes is essential for maintaining fleet availability and keeping operations moving smoothly.

Vehicle Types and Configurations

Your fleet is likely not uniform. Consider the different types of vehicles that will need washing.

  • Standard Tractor-Trailers: Most automated systems are designed to handle standard semi-trucks and trailers.
  • Irregular Shapes: Do you have tankers, car carriers, garbage trucks, or vehicles with specialized equipment? Some systems, particularly touchless ones, are better at cleaning non-standard shapes. Brush systems with contouring technology can also adapt to different vehicle profiles.
  • Delicate Surfaces: If your trucks have expensive custom graphics, wraps, or polished aluminum, a touchless system may be preferable to avoid any potential for abrasion. Alternatively, modern soft-touch brush systems use non-abrasive materials that are safe for most finishes.

Operational Goals and Priorities

What are you trying to achieve with a new wash system?

  • Speed and Throughput: Is your main goal to reduce vehicle downtime and wash as many trucks as possible each day? If so, a drive-through system is your best bet.
  • Cost Reduction: Are you focused on cutting long-term costs related to labor, water, and detergents? Look for automated systems with water reclamation and precise chemical metering.
  • Wash Quality and Consistency: If achieving a perfect, uniform clean on every vehicle is your top priority, an automated system with advanced sensor technology will outperform manual methods.

Comparing Truck Wash Equipment Options

Once you have a clear profile of your needs, you can evaluate the primary types of truck wash equipment available on the market.

Manual Pressure Washing Systems

This is the most basic setup, involving handheld pressure washers, brushes, and manual labor.

  • Best for: Very small fleets, occasional deep cleaning, or businesses with a very limited initial budget.
  • Pros: Low upfront cost, ability to detail specific problem areas.
  • Cons: Extremely labor-intensive, slow, inconsistent results, high water and chemical usage, and potential for improper wastewater runoff.

Gantry (Rollover) Systems

In a gantry system, the truck parks in a wash bay, and a robotic unit moves back and forth over the vehicle to perform the wash cycles.

  • Best for: Small to medium-sized fleets, facilities with limited space, and operations with a mix of vehicle types.
  • Pros: Requires a smaller footprint than a drive-through system, provides a thorough and consistent wash, can be operated by a single person.
  • Cons: Slower throughput than a drive-through system, as only one vehicle can be washed at a time.

Drive-Through Systems

These systems consist of a series of arches that a truck drives through slowly. Each arch performs a specific function, such as pre-soaking, high-pressure washing, brushing, rinsing, and waxing.

  • Best for: Large, high-volume fleets where speed and efficiency are paramount.
  • Pros: Extremely fast throughput (washing a truck in minutes), highly efficient, capable of handling a continuous flow of vehicles.
  • Cons: Requires a larger physical footprint and a higher initial investment.

Touchless vs. Friction (Soft-Touch) Systems

Within automated options, you’ll need to decide between touchless and friction-based cleaning.

  • Touchless Systems: Rely entirely on high-pressure water jets and specialized chemical detergents to remove dirt. They are excellent for protecting delicate surfaces and cleaning irregular shapes. However, they may struggle with removing heavy, caked-on road film without aggressive chemicals.
  • Friction (Soft-Touch) Systems: Use large, rotating brushes made of a soft, non-abrasive material to gently scrub the vehicle’s surface. This physical agitation is highly effective at removing stubborn grime. Modern brush technology is safe for almost all vehicle finishes and provides a superior clean.
  • Hybrid Systems: The best of both worlds. These systems combine high-pressure touchless washing for sensitive areas with soft-touch brushes for flat surfaces, delivering a comprehensive clean.

Case Study: Choosing the Right Fit for Growth

A regional food distributor with a fleet of 40 refrigerated box trucks was struggling with their manual wash process. It took two workers nearly an hour per truck, creating a constant backlog and delaying departures. After assessing their needs, they realized their priority was speed and consistency. They chose to invest in a compact, automated drive-through system.

The results were immediate. Wash time per truck dropped to under 15 minutes, and the process could be managed by a single employee. The company was able to wash every truck weekly instead of monthly, improving brand perception and food safety compliance. The fleet manager noted that the reduction in labor costs alone resulted in a full return on their investment in just under two years.

Key Considerations for Your Investment

Beyond the type of system, consider these crucial features:

  • Water Reclamation: A water recycling system can cut water consumption by up to 80%, leading to massive utility savings and a more sustainable operation.
  • Undercarriage Wash: Essential for removing corrosive salt and de-icing agents that can destroy a truck’s chassis.
  • Chemical and Wax Application: Automated systems ensure the precise application of detergents and protective waxes, improving results and preventing waste.
  • Service and Support: Choose a manufacturer with a reputation for reliability, quality installation, and readily available technical support and parts.
